Core: The technical mechanism behind the 25% cut is a mix of software and hardware optimization. From my own experience auditing the LUNA burn mechanism during the Terra collapse, I recognize that when a narrative lacks granular data, it's often because the truth is inconvenient. In this case, the article fails to distinguish between a reduction in API sale price and a true reduction in production cost. The former can be a strategic loss leader; the latter requires genuine engineering breakthroughs. Based on my analysis of industry trends, the price cut is likely a combination of both, but with a heavy skew toward the strategic side. The labs are using cost engineering—prefix caching, continuous batching, and adaptive routing to smaller models—to lower their marginal cost per token, but they are also willing to sacrifice margin to capture market share. This is quantified tribalism at its finest: the tribes are not just developers; they are entire ecosystems fighting for the same pool of API calls. Moreover, the hidden information is telling. The article's emphasis on "US labs" is a clear signal of geopolitical competition. The real threat is not each other but the open-source movement from China and Meta. The price cut is a defensive wall, not an offensive weapon. For crypto projects, this means that the cost advantage of decentralized networks is shrinking, not growing. If centralized labs can offer inference at near-cost, the value proposition for DePIN tokens—which rely on token incentives to compete—becomes weaker. The Jevons paradox will likely cause total compute demand to rise, but that demand will be captured by hyperscalers, not by a network of idle GPUs on the blockchain. Contrarian: The contrarian angle is that the 25% cut is a narrative trap for crypto investors. The story being sold is that cheaper AI inference leads to more on-chain AI activity, which boosts token prices. But the reality is that the price war is a sign of commoditization, and commoditization erodes the margins of all players except the most efficient. In the crypto world, we have seen this before with Layer2 sequencers. As I argued in my own research, "Layer2 sequencers are basically single centralized nodes; 'decentralized sequencing' has been a PowerPoint for two years." The same applies here: the inference optimization is a centralized efficiency gain, not a step toward decentralization. The labs are using sophisticated routing and caching to reduce costs, but these techniques require central coordination and control—exactly the opposite of what DeFi and Web3 stand for. The crypto community should be skeptical of any narrative that equates lower prices with a more decentralized future. If anything, this price war will accelerate the centralization of AI infrastructure, as only the largest players can afford to sustain such price cuts.
